1. Why convert my VHS tapes to DVD?
VHS Tapes deteriorate over time and wear out, but DVD's can last for generations when well cared for. DVD's have been projected to last over 100 years!
A few other reasons is that DVD's take up considerably less space than a VHS tape which allows you to have more and still have the same amount of storage or even more room. You don't have to rewind DVD's when finished watching them. DVD's are digital copies and copies we create from our DVD's are exactly the same as the origional with no loss of quality.

4. Will my DVD work everywhere?
Please note that some older models do not play DVD-R and DVD+R's. Please ensure that your DVD Player can play DVD-R's and DVD+R's. If you are unsure whether your player can play DVD recordables contact the store where you bought it and ask them a few questions.
